Reiki may help to increase circulation or decrease pain and may also help with insomnia. ABOUT - HISTORY & MISSION History. In 1978, Hospice of the Good Shepherd was created as the first hospice in Massachusetts by a compassionate, visionary group of people from the Parish of the Good Shepherd, an Episcopal Church in Newton. Good Shepherd emerged from its community with the belief that the community wanted to, and could care for itself. GOOD SHEPHERD COVID-19 UPDATE & PRECAUTIONS The well-being and protection of our patients, their loved ones and our staff has and continues to be at the center of Good Shepherd Community Care’s mission. We are continuing to actively monitor the COVID-19 pandemic and respond to this evolving public health event. We are closely following guidelines from the Centers for Disease Control (CDC) and the Massachusetts Department of Public Health (MDPH). Because our patients and often their loved ones are at the greatest risk for developing severe illness from COVID-19, we are doing everything possible to protect them. Good Shepherd employees regularly comply with federal OSHA regulations and state guidelines concerning universal health care precautions. In addition, the following procedures are in place: ● Employees and Volunteers are required to stay home when feelingsick.
● Employees and Volunteers returning from COVID-19 affected areas may not return to the office or see patients until 14 days aftertheir return.
● Employees with symptoms of Upper Respiratory Infection (URI) (fever, cough, SOB and sore throat) are required to stay home, and will not be allowed to return until it is clear that they are not infected with COVID-19. Staff members who note symptoms of a URI in a co-worker are encouraged to share their concerns with a supervisor. In these circumstances, Good Shepherd will take appropriate action and employees will not return to work unless and until it is deemed safe to do so. ● Employees and Volunteers who have been exposed to someone with confirmed or presumed exposure to COVID-19 must report this to their supervisor and may not return to work for 14 days. ● Employees are not permitted to attend any conferences at thistime.
● Employees are instructed to avoid large public gatherings. ● Patient visits in most facilities have been reduced to nurses, social workers, spiritual care providers and home health aides to comply with department of public health guidelines. ● Cleaning services at our office locations include the regular disinfection of all surfaces such as door knobs, handles andrailings.
● Good Shepherd maintains a supply of hand sanitizer, anti-bacterial wipes and PPE (Personal Protective Equipment). Due to limited commercial supplies we will only use PPE when indicated in order to conserve supplies for when they are truly needed.Beginning 3/16/20:
● All routine work-related meetings will be conductedremotely/virtually.
● Good Shepherd will activate a telework plan that will encourage social distancing to reduce any chance of COVID-19 transmission amongits staff.
Please be assured that Good Shepherd is committed to keeping our patients, their loved ones and our staff healthy. If you have additional questions or concerns feel free to contact us at (617) 969-6130 or email us at info@gscommunitycare.org.PROGRAMS & SERVICES
